This piece is really a homage to Pablo Moncayo, as the form is based on his Huapango. There are differences, the main one being that the Huapango was written for orchestra and this work was written for symphonic band. The piece weas commissioned by Moorpark College and premiered by Brendan McMullin with the Moorpark Band. For this recording, the piece was performed by Steven Piazza and members of the LA Winds, which is the premiere symphonic band in Los Angeles. The reason that the piece is titled Jarocho LA 2 is because I was inspired by the vibrancy of the element that is typical of the Son Jarocho, which is a style of "son jarocho", which is a Mexican folk music and dance style from Veracruz, blending Spanish, African, and Indigenous roots. And the L.A. part of the tytle is there because, well, I wrote it in L.A., a true melting pot of cultures where many ethnic groups are represented. I hope you enjoy it.
